Dining Benches : Yay or Nay ?

Are you in the process of choosing furniture for your dining room ? If you are, then chances are, you may have considered whether a table with dining benches is a good option for you. A dining bench can be an excellent way of updating the look and feel of your dining space. Whether you have cosy breakfast nook to furnish or a grand dining hall, there are many bench seating options to choose from to create the look you want.

The Advantages of Dining Benches

1. Seating Capacity :

Modern refectory table and benchesThis is, of course, one of the key benefits – you can squeeze more around the table if you want to. If you  like to entertain, or have a large family, this is the ideal scenario. Benches great for gatherings where extra seating is required. Whereas chairs are limited to one person each, a bench seat can hold several people.

The Contemporary Refectory Table on the right is shown with two Zen Dining Benches, one with a back and one without.

2. Space Saving : Simple modern oak banquette dining nook

A kitchen bench will take up less room than a dining chair. If you have a cosy corner to fit a dining table in and you are short on space, then a banquette style bench could be the answer. There’ll be no need to pull out chairs, just slide in on the bench and use dining chairs on the remaining side. Opt for a dining table with a pedestal leg to allow easy access.

3. A relaxed feel : Contemporary oak refectory table and zen bench

On top of being super stylish, dining benches can also help to set the particular vibe of your dining room. Along with being more laid back benches can make the your kitchen space look more inviting and informal.

4. Better Interaction Corner bench seating in the dining room

People can sit closer and feel more connected to one another when sitting on a bench. Bench seating therefore promotes communication and intimacy and provides a cozier atmosphere for socializing.

5. Opens up your kitchen space :

Chiswick oak table ad benchBecause of it’s minimalist design a bench seating will help reduce the visual clutter in your dining room. The whole room will feel cleaner, neater and more inviting as a result. Scandinavian style tables with benches have this look off to a T!

6. A design feature : A zen bench in a white kitchen on jersey

A bench seat can also make a great item of décor in your house. If you have an upholstered bench, choose fabrics that look stylish and elegant. On an un-upholstered   bench use cushions and throws to add pops of colour and texture. This will significantly enhance the look of your dining room. You can even use your bench elsewhere in the house to make a feature all by itself under. A cosy window seat or as a feature in the hallway.

7. A variety of options : Dining table and bench with curved legs

There is no single norm or style when it comes to bench seats. Your kitchen bench can come in a variety of styles and shapes. You can opt for a dining bench with back, without back, upholstered, with storage underneath, built in, corner seating, curved, to fit under your table when not in use. Your choice is not limited to a flat and straight bench.

8. An open view : A modern refectory table and two benches

If your dining space is small then choose a table and bench set with no back; this will make a small space feel bigger and less interrupted. This is particularly useful if you have a gorgeous view you want to make the most of.

9. Benches are cost effective :

Bespoke oak dining bench handmadeThe price of one bench can be less expensive than several dining chairs in the same space. You get extra seating capacity, and versatility in a single item so it can be a much more cost-effective option.

What Size Dining Bench do I need ?

Beyond style the most important thing to work out before buying a bench is to work out what dimensions you will need:

  • Length – if you want your bench to slide in between the legs of your table, be sure to leave a 5 to 10 cm gap. If you have plenty of room and want to get the maximum seating capacity out of your bench, go the whole length of your table.
  • height – your bench should be the same height as any chairs you’ll be using. Average heights range from 45 cm to 50 cm, so be sure to check the height is right for your table. Remember if you plan to use cushions, these can add height too.
  • width – a bench that is too narrow can be uncomfortable, so make sure you choose one with plenty of width to accommodate the average derrière!
